Derrick Duke's career spans over three decades in healthcare and insurance, with a focus on financial leadership and operational efficiency. His tenure at companies like HealthMarkets, National Health Insurance, and Magellan Health has been defined by a consistent ability to optimize complex organizations while expanding their market footprint. At HealthMarkets, where he served as CFO and COO for 15 years, Duke oversaw the company's acquisition by
in 2019—a testament to his strategic vision and execution capabilities.Since joining Magellan Health in 2020 as Chief Risk Officer, Duke has methodically ascended the leadership ranks, serving as COO and CFO before assuming the CEO role. His dual expertise in finance and operations has already yielded tangible results: streamlined cost structures, improved provider partnerships, and a renewed focus on behavioral health innovation. Digital Health and Behavioral Care
The rise of digital therapeutics is reshaping mental health delivery, and Magellan Health is at the forefront. The company's digital cognitive behavioral therapy (DCBT) programs, such as FearFighter® and MoodCalmer®, have demonstrated measurable clinical outcomes for anxiety and depression. Duke has accelerated the adoption of these tools, recognizing their potential to reduce costs while improving accessibility. For example, partnerships with platforms like NeuroFlow and ThinkHeroSM have expanded offerings for youth and high-risk populations, creating a scalable model for behavioral health.
Operational Efficiency and Value-Based Care
Duke's financial expertise has been instrumental in refining Magellan Health's approach to value-based reimbursement. By aligning incentives with quality outcomes, the company has incentivized providers to deliver cost-effective care without compromising standards. This model has already yielded success: Magellan Health's CMS audit for Medicare Part D achieved a perfect score, underscoring its compliance and operational rigor. Additionally, collaborations with entities like Concert Genetics and Kyo highlight Duke's focus on data-driven decision-making and niche market solutions (e.g., autism care).
Geographic and Contractual Expansion
Magellan Health's market presence has grown significantly under Duke. Recent contracts in Nevada, Idaho, and Louisiana—such as administering the Idaho Behavioral Health Transformation program—underscore the company's ability to secure partnerships in states with high unmet behavioral health needs. These expansions are not just geographic but also strategic: they align with the federal government's push for integrated care models and Medicaid managed care.
